Handover note for review: I'm passing the Quellbird alert deduplicator to you mid-refactor. The fingerprinting logic now hashes normalized labels, but the suppression window is still hardcoded at 300s; see the TODO in window.go. Tests cover flapping alerts but not cross-cluster duplicates. Please review the pending branch carefully before merging. Post-handover, ownership of this component rests with the engineer named below.

signatory, kaweg-fawig: Zorys Druys Jorius Novael

Canary gating for Bramblewick deploys: canary gets 5% traffic for 30 minutes. Auto-rollback triggers on error rate >0.5%, p99 latency +20%, or any OOM kill. Manual promotion requires two approvals outside the deploying team. Do not bypass gates for hotfixes — use the expedited lane instead. Full gating rules live on the page below.

wiki page, tahaf-tajog: https://jira.ordindyn.corp/pipeline

Marit, before I roll off, here's the state of the timetable solver. The constraint engine now handles split-year cohorts correctly; the fix landed in release 4.2 and is covered by the regression suite under tests/cohorts. Watch the room-capacity heuristic — it degrades badly if the staging dataset lacks annex rooms, so always seed Brindlemoor Academy's full fixture set first. Solver timeouts are tuned per environment and must not be copied blindly between them. The current production configuration is as follows.

deployment values, kajep-kageg:
[praix]
host = praix.paliqcorp.corp
user = praix_svc
database = praix_prod

Ticket: spare-hardware storage room, Basement B, Alderwick House. The overhead light in the back aisle has failed and the motion sensor near the racking is intermittent, so night-shift staff should bring a torch until repairs are done. A replacement fitting has been ordered through Greystep Electrical and should arrive within the week. Please log any equipment removed during the outage on the paper sheet taped inside the door. The badge reader is also offline, so night-shift entry is via the keypad using this code.

door code, yagap-bahof: bdg-O-05